TURIN | Grattacielo Intesa San Paolo | 167 M / 549 FT | 39 FLOORS

Yesterday the last episode of S.Paolo tower in Turin. The problem of this high rise building is its highness: 200 m. People organized an association to say a big No to the tower and distributed a scary simulation/picture of the skyscraper in the city: in other words, no towers/obstacles between the Mole Antonelliana (the major landmark of Turin) and the amazing landscape of Alps. Renzo Piano answered them with some sketches. The association proposed a third simulation. Yesterday Renzo Piano proposed to reduce the highness of tower to 166 mt. instead of 200 mt. Nothing is gonna change... waiting for the 5th simulation.

Actually the project was delivered in june 2006, before San Paolo joined Intesa (August 2006). So, you can call it, San Paolo/IMI, or if you prefer Intesa/San Paolo.
